
Measles outbreak shows a global threat
Worker from India tied to Hub cases
The virus landed in Boston on April 26, a Wednesday. It was brewing inside a young computer programmer who had flown in from India, brought over for his expertise by a financial services company headquartered in the city's tallest skyscraper. (Full article: 1275 words)
